This video explores the potential of sodium-ion batteries as a disruptive force in the EV industry, particularly for Tesla's upcoming affordable models. The reviewer highlights significant advantages over traditional lithium-ion batteries, including lower production costs (estimated at $50-$70/kWh vs. $100-$150/kWh for lithium-ion), faster charging times (0-80% in 12 minutes), improved durability, and superior performance in extreme cold temperatures (-25°C to 65°C). The technology, championed by companies like Navolt and Bedrock Materials, boasts an energy density close to current lithium-ion cells (210 Wh/kg vs. 120-260 Wh/kg for lithium-ion) and a projected lifespan of over a decade. A key takeaway is the potential for sodium-ion batteries to enable Tesla's $25,000 EV, making electric transportation more accessible. While energy density remains a challenge compared to high-end lithium-ion, the cost, safety, and charging speed benefits are presented as compelling trade-offs for mass-market vehicles. The video suggests that automakers are actively pursuing this technology to reduce costs and diversify supply chains, with potential for commercialization as early as 2024.
